    The procedure of Invisalign treatment

    Introduction

    A confident, wide smile has a long-lasting effect on your mood and how other people see you. Although metal braces have always been the preferred treatment for crooked teeth, people are now looking for a more discreet and practical option.     The first consultation

    An in-depth discussion is the first step in the process. In this appointment, your dentist analyzes your oral health, talks about your smile objectives, and decides if Invisalign is the best option for you. Complex imaging methods like 3D scanning or imprints may be used at this point. These scans support the creation of a digital procedure that provides a look at your potential outcomes and demonstrates how your teeth will change over time.

    Developing a customized treatment strategy

    The dentist creates a customized treatment strategy if you are approved as a candidate. The strategy describes the precise tooth motions at every phase, the anticipated timeframe, and the quantity of aligners you’ll require. Every stage of the procedure is designed using sophisticated software. You can see your expected smile through computer simulations. Aligners are designed to provide steady, mild pressure. Progress is monitored and modified as necessary.

    Getting your initial aligners

    When you get the initial set of aligners, the anticipation grows. The process of gradually moving your teeth into line is started by these brackets, which fit tightly over the surfaces of your teeth. Individuals are advised to use aligners for 20-22 hours a day for maximum efficiency. Only removing during meals, brushing, and flossing is advised. Following your dentist’s instructions, changing to the next pair of aligners every one to two weeks is crucial.

    Getting used to your aligners

    Many people underestimate how simple it is to live with Invisalign aligners. Most individuals rapidly get used to the schedule, even though there is a brief adjustment phase. To prevent trays from being lost, always carry your aligner container. To avoid discoloration, brush and wash your aligners frequently. For quicker, more reliable results, maintain a constant use-time.

    Progress evaluations

    You should visit your dentist regularly throughout your treatment. Compared to regular braces procedures, these visits are typically fewer and quicker. At every examination, your dentist will make sure that your teeth are moving according to the customized strategy, and you’ll receive your upcoming aligner sets. If treatment has to be refined, the necessary changes will be made. To keep your experience on course and make sure your smile changes as planned, these checkups are essential. Your smile will significantly change after wearing your final set of aligners. While finishing your Invisalign experience is a significant milestone, keeping the results is essential.
